Mobile Publishing and Advertising Seminar - Melbourne
Chairperson: Amanda Gome, Publisher, SmartCompany
Speakers: Antony McGregor Dey, CEO, QMCodes; Alex Young, Founder and CEO, Mostyle; Gregan McMahon, Group Manager, Product & Marketing, Sensis
Mobile is an emerging channel for media companies to promote content to existing consumers while expanding their reach and connect with new audiences. Building a mobile presence offers a new advertising platform to generate revenue. In this seminar we will look at the different types of mobile publishing available including: mobile websites, social media and QR Codes.

Future of Media : Summit 2008 - Sydney, Australia and Silicon Valley, USA
The third annual Future of Media Summit 2008 will be a unique experience, linking highly participatory events on both sides of the Pacific to create deep insights into the future of media. Key features of the Future of Media Summit 2008 include:
Simultaneous events in Silicon Valley and Sydney merged seamlessly by video, online discussion, and cross-continental panels and conversations
Highly participatory Conference AND Unconference formats at both Sydney and Silicon Valley events
Discussions on global media strategies, future of journalism, future of privacy, and the future of TV and video
Peer video discussions by participants across continents (world-first)
Prediction markets on the future of the media before and during the Summit to tap collective wisdom of event participants and global media leader
Future of Media Summit blog for insights and discussion by all speakers and participants
Detailed content and analysis, including the Future of Media Report 2008
Confirmed speakers include Mark Scott, Managing Director, ABC, Mark Dorney, CEO, Macquarie Media Group, Loic Le Meur, CEO, Seesmic, Chris Saad, Chair, Dataportability.org, Hugh Martin, General Manager, APN Online, Wendy Hogan, Managing Director, CNET Networks Australia and many other media leaders on both sides of the Pacific.

NSW Women going global - Sydney
Join the launch of NSW Women Going Global, and become part of an exciting new initiative that supports and empowers women to achieve their international goals.
NSW Women Going Global brings together women involved in international trade to strengthen skills, opportunities and contacts.
It is an initiative of Australian Business International Trade Services and the NSW Department of State and Regional Development to recognise the achievements of women doing business internationally, and to encourage and support others.
The launch will unveil a dynamic program of activities and give you the chance to become part of a new wave of women supporting each other to achieve international success.
